Pepperoncini Potato Salad Recipe

This Pepperoncini Potato Salad Recipe delivers a zesty, bright update to the classic side dish by incorporating pickled peppers for a perfect flavor balance. By combining creamy textures and sharp, acidic notes, you create a crowd-pleasing choice.

  • Total Time: 35 mins
  • Yield: 8 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 lbs Gold Potatoes (Cut into 1-inch cubes)
  • 1/2 cup Pepperoncini (Finely chopped)
  • 1 cup Mayonnaise (Use high-quality full fat)
  • 2 stalks Celery (Finely diced)
  • 3 stems Green Onions (Sliced thinly)
  • 2 tbsp Fresh Dill (Chopped finely)
  • 2 tbsp Pepperoncini Brine (Adds bold zest)

Instructions

  1. Place the cubed gold potatoes into a large pot of salted cold water.
  2. Bring the water to a boil over medium-high heat.
  3. Reduce the heat and simmer until the potatoes are tender when pierced with a fork.
  4. Drain the potatoes thoroughly in a colander and allow them to cool completely.
  5. Transfer the cooled potatoes to a large mixing bowl to prepare for the dressing.
  6. Whisk the mayonnaise, pepperoncini brine, and fresh dill together in a separate small bowl.
  7. Add the chopped pepperoncini, diced celery, and sliced green onions to the bowl with the potatoes.
  8. Pour the creamy mayonnaise dressing over the potato mixture carefully.
  9. Fold the ingredients together gently to ensure the potatoes remain whole and uncrushed.
  10. Chill the Pepperoncini Potato Salad Recipe in the refrigerator for at least sixty minutes before serving.

Notes

Salt your boiling water generously to ensure the potatoes develop flavor from the inside out during the cooking process. Use a waxy potato variety, such as Yukon Gold, to keep the pieces intact while you toss the Pepperoncini Potato Salad Recipe with the dressing. Always allow your potatoes to reach room temperature before applying the dressing, as hot potatoes will melt the mayonnaise and ruin the creamy consistency. Add the crispy elements, like celery, just before serving if you want to maintain maximum crunch in your final Pepperoncini Potato Salad Recipe. Adjust the heat of your salad by tasting the pepperoncini brine before adding it, as some brands are spicier than others.
